IMO Cotto has lost something since Marg, expecially confidence wise. Proved against Clottey he still had the balls when he carried on even with the possibility of an early night via TD, but he just seems a bit more indecisive and hesitant.
Still, some people have gone way overboard after the Hatton KO about Pac's power, seeming to forget that he pummeled a drained Oscar for 8 rounds without dropping him, and a little longer even to take out the lightweight Diaz. Pac's best chance is by decision.
